We were visiting the Salton Sea and Joshua tree national park. We were driving back and forth when we were hungry. We checked Google maps at saw Mexicali cafe. BEST SUGGESTION. It started with an excellent young man named cesar who suggested we get these shrimp filled pepper. Which we did do and only wished we ordered more. Then we each had our main dishes and left very satisfied. So satisfied that we returned the next day, out of our way and each ordered a shrimp pepper plate each along with an equally amazing guacamole sauce. Thank you so much to Cesar for an amazing experience.

The food is great! Almost as good as Grandma makes! Fajitas are my favorite thing on the menu, and they can make a killer margarita. Everyone is is attentive and ready to assist. Great place for a casual dinner.

Visiting the area from NC, we asked a "local" to recommend a good Mexican restaurant and were directed here. We had fish tacos and Chile rellenos - both very good. The service was unbeatable. Great recommendation!

Great food! I love mexican food and this place is amazing. You have to get the shrimp stuffed peppers. The service was fantastic! Our waiter was super quick, very helpful with the menu and just a fun friendly guy. We will definitely be back!
